Beware thief selling toothbrushes

POLICE are investigating an early morning break-in at the Superdrug store in Biggin Street at Dover.

The thief smashed a window to get into the premises between 1.30am and 1.45am on Friday (March 3) and stole aftershaves, perfumes and toothbrushes.

Police would like to hear from witnesses who saw anyone acting suspiciously and also from anyone who has seen someone trying to sell these types of items.
